What is the importance of the San Juan Festival in Mexico
The Festival of San Juan is celebrated on June 24 in Mexico and is a festival that combines elements of Catholic tradition with pre-Hispanic rituals and practices. It is an occasion to pay homage to the patron saint, as well as to celebrate the summer solstice with purification rituals, ceremonial baths and bonfires, which symbolize renewal and fertility.

What regulations govern tax debtors in Guatemala?
Tax debtors in Guatemala are primarily regulated by the Tax Code and other tax laws. These laws establish the obligations of taxpayers, the deadlines for filing returns and paying taxes, and the penalties for non-compliance. In addition, the Superintendency of Tax Administration (SAT) is the entity in charge of collecting and supervising taxes in the country.
